I think he might mean that crankcase pressure is pushing oil past the seal...tboling, have you checked your crankcase vent tube for blockage...just read your post again, yes you did. That sort of blowby seems abnormal---is your timing cover somehow tweaked so that it doesn't align properly with the crank? My engine has 400k and I just had the timing cover off---the crank has no groove at all...did you get the speedie sleeve and seal as a matched set?
